True ceramic software
Most people think that ceramic means clay. Well, they are correct but it is not only clay. Ceramic cookware can mean a few other different things as well. Breaking it down for you true ceramic cookware is the most orthodox ceramic material that is used in making cookware.
You will ideally find clay in this type of cookware. The item is given shape from wet clay and is therefore also called pottery item. The item when given shape is then fired at regulated temperature to render its usual stability and durability. These fired items are then properly glazed to give it the desired finish. If it is glazed properly according to the permissible limits of the state and the desired standard is followed, cooking your food in such a piece will not leach metals into your food. The metals that you will usually find in true ceramic cookware made from clay includes silicon and aluminum. It may also contain a few impurities such as sulfur, arsenic and phosphorous. Manufacturers usually use heavy metals such as cadmium and lead to glaze these true ceramic items. This is something that you should be concerned of and watch out for when you buy these items. Moreover, color glazed items may also contain other metals in the pigment.It is therefore recommended that you look for ceramic items from reputable and reliable sources only such as Tayloright and others that claims that their glaze is free from heavy metals and of toxic pigments.
Glass ceramic cookware
You will also come across glass ceramic cookware in which the primary ingredient is the glass. There are different materials used to make glass such as sand, soda ash, gypsum, dolomite and limestone.
Apart from that there are also a large number of minerals found in glass. These minerals include calcium, sulfur, magnesium, sodium, silicon and carbon.
All these minerals and materials helps in the heat processing when you use glass ceramic cookware. This heat processing is called Vitrification. This is an essential process that is required in order to attain the inertness of the glass that will eventually allow you to heat your food properly. This process will also help in the elimination of the chances of silicon and other harmful elements ingesting in your food.
There is a second heating process required to turn the glass into ceramic. This process also makes glass ceramic less porous than traditional clay ceramic and also makes it higher in strength.
